如何利用模拟软件提升开发效率有哪些推荐

时间:2025-12-06 分类:电脑软件

在现代软件开发中,提升效率已成为每位开发者的追求。随着技术的不断进步,各类模拟软件层出不穷,它们为开发者提供了便利,帮助提升工作效率和代码质量。通过模拟与仿真,开发人员可以在实际开发之前预见可能的问题,从而减少了后期的调试时间。今天,我们将探讨如何有效利用这些模拟软件来提高开发效率,并推荐一些值得尝试的工具,以帮助您更快地完成项目任务。

如何利用模拟软件提升开发效率有哪些推荐

开发者可以使用模拟软件进行早期的设计验证。比如在产品开发初期,通过建模可以直观地呈现设计理念,并进行多次测试。这样可以在投入更多资源之前,发现设计中的潜在问题,大大降低了开发风险。以MATLAB/Simulink为例,它在控制系统设计与仿真领域被广泛使用,通过强大的图形界面和算法库,助力开发者迅速搭建并测试模型。

利用虚拟仿真工具,可以在虚拟环境中进行实际操作。像Unity和Unreal Engine等游戏引擎,不仅适用于游戏开发,也可用于其他领域的沉浸式仿真。通过这些工具,开发者能够模拟复杂场景,实现交互,并通过实时反馈不断优化设计。这样,不仅可以提高开发效率,还能提升最终产品的用户体验。

自动化测试软件在提升开发效率方面同样重要。比如Selenium和JUnit等自动化测试工具,可以帮助开发者快速执行回归测试和单元测试,极大地减少了人工测试带来的时间损耗。通过引入自动化测试,开发团队能够快速迭代,确保软件的稳定性和安全性。

综合使用这些模拟软件,还能促进团队协作。许多现代工具支持云端协作,便于团队成员之间的实时沟通与反馈。例如,使用JIRA或者Trello管理项目进度,让团队在透明的环境中工作,有助于加快决策和实施的效率。

合理利用模拟软件可以显著提升开发效率。从早期设计验证到自动化测试,再到团队协作管理,这些工具都是现代开发者不可或缺的助力。希望能够为您在软件开发过程中提供实用的参考与指导。